Address

3C9Bso7uMhtVVH1vecNtqWJvqw1JEM1fts
Confirmed tx count
80
Confirmed received
40 outputs (0.26153042 BTC)
Confirmed spent
40 outputs (0.26153042 BTC)
Confirmed unspent
No outputs

25-50 of 80 Transactions